  • Publication number: 20070049692
    Abstract: The single-layered structure of the invention comprises (A) 50 to 97% by weight of a polyolefin, (B) 2 to 45% by weight of a polyamide resin comprising a diamine component and a dicarboxylic acid component and (C) 1 to 45% by weight of a modified polyolefin and/or styrene copolymer. The polyamide resin B is dispersed in layers throughout the single-layered structure. With such a dispersion state of the polyamide resin B, the single-layered structure exhibits excellent fuel barrier properties.

  • Publication number: 20060270799
    Abstract: A thermoplastic resin article which includes a layer made of a thermoplastic resin composition containing 50 to 97% by weight of a polyolefin A, 2 to 45% by weight of a barrier resin B, and 1 to 45% by weight of a modified polyolefin Ca and/or a styrene copolymer Cb. The ratio of the melt viscosities of the polyolefin A and the barrier resin B satisfies the formula: 0.7<MVB/MVA<2.8 wherein MVA is a melt viscosity (Pa·s) of the polyolefin A and MVB is a melt viscosity (Pa·s) of the barrier resin B, each measured under a shear rate of 100 s?1 at a temperature from MP+2° C. to MP+10° C. wherein MP is the melting point of the barrier resin B. The thermoplastic resin article exhibits good fuel barrier properties and impact resistance.
